Foreigners travelling to India can now get visa extended online

Foreigners touring India need not go to the Foreigners Registration Office/Foreigners Regional Registration Office (FRO/FRRO) in person to registration or visa extension services, as it is from now onwards, can be done online through an e-FRRO platform. Union Home Minister Rajnath Singh launched the web-based application e-FRRO scheme aimed at providing fast and efficient visa-related services online to visitors to India. The scheme has already been implemented and is running successfully as a pilot project in four FRROs in Bengaluru, Chennai, Delhi and Mumbai since February 12. Philippine Airlines appoints Bird Group its representative in India

Philippine Airlines (PAL), the flag carrier of Philippines, has appointed Bird Travels Private Ltd, the Airline Management Services arm of Bird Group, as its local representative in India. The association marks the airline’s latest step in developing its sales distribution network within the Indian market. The appointment of Bird Travels is a part of the intensive preparations undertaken by Philippine Airlines to realize its firm plans to commence operations to India by Winter 2018, the airlines said in a statement. ITDC to develop mega-tourism project

The India Tourism Development Corporation (ITDC) has signed an MOU with Hyderabad-based Suraas Impex for developing a mega tourism destination project at Bairav Lanka in Kakinada, East Godavari District of Andhra Pradesh. The first phase of the project is estimated to cost Rs 550 crores. This project is the first of its kind for the state-owned ITDC with any private player. Haryana strengthens infrastructure to promote religious tourism

The Haryana government said it is planning to strengthen its infrastructure to promote religious tourism related to Kurukshetra. The Haryana Tourism Department is reported to have decided to spend Rs 38.31 crore on the beautification of ‘Brahm Sarover’ and Rs 32.33 crore on ‘Jyotisar’ under various schemes. Under the Swadesh Darshan Scheme of the central government, an amount of Rs 97.34 crore had been allocated for the ‘Sri Krishna Circuit’ out of which Rs 32 crore had been spent on the development of Brahma Sarovar, Jyotisar, Narkaataari, Sanniihit Sarovar and beautification of the Kurukshetra city. Homestays mushrooming in Uttarakhand’s Darma valley

Darma valley in Uttarakhand’s Pithoragarh district has been a quaint, small village town unnoticed by travel buffs. Now, it is abuzz with tourists and so as the homestays in the town. About 125 families in the valley are now providing homestay facilities to visitors. Kumaon Mandal Vikas Nigam (KMVN), a state government undertaking, is giving them training and ensured sanitation facilities for the guests. Drama, Vyans, Chaundas and Johar are the four tribal valleys, of which Vyans and Johar valleys have been promoted as tourist destinations. Rajasthan marks 10.50% rise in tourist arrivals

Rajasthan tourism marks a remarkable increase in tourist arrival, as in 2017 around 475.27 lakh, tourists visited the state which is higher in number when compared with the previous statistics. Around 16.10 lakhs arrivals, out of the total number were foreign tourists with the other half being domestic tourists. More foreign tourists are getting attracted to the state, which is filled with rich heritage and history in the form of forts, arts, festivals and architecture.
